Earlier this month legendary punter Dustin Colquitt announced his retirement after 15 seasons with the Kansas City Chiefs. He signed a one-day contract to retire with the team despite not playing in the NFL since the 2021 season.
The Kansas City Chiefs closed out the 2024 NFL season with a historic run that saw them finish with a 15-2 regular-season record, secure their ninth consecutive AFC West title and advance to their third straight Super Bowl, before falling to the Philadelphia Eagles, 40-22, in Super Bowl LIX.

If the Chiefs stay in Missouri, the plan is to renovate the team's current home, GEHA Field at Arrowhead Stadium. The Royals, however, have looked into leaving Kauffman Stadium, which shares its parking lots with Arrowhead, to move to another part of the city.
The entertainment studio launched by the NFL’s Kansas City Chiefs has set its executive team, The Hollywood Reporter has learned. Foolish Club Studios, the venture that the Chiefs announced just before this year’s Super Bowl, will be led by CEO Mark Donovan and COO Lara Krug.
